Senior Hayden Knott continued his unbeaten streak on Saturday (May 1), winning two events and setting one meet record in the fifth 12-school Rantoul Invitational.
Knott hurled the discus 176 feet, 2 inches, breaking the meet mark. He also holds the freshmen-sophomore meet record at Rantoul, 152-4, set in 2019.
Knott captured top honors in the shot put with a season-best 56 feet, 2 ¾ inches.
SJ-O won seven individual events and two relays while securing team honors, with a meet-record point total of 178. Runner-up Monticello totaled 162 points and third-place Rantoul had 106 points. SJ-O was a first-time team champion at the Rantoul meet.
Spartan senior Brandon Mattsey was the 1,600-meter winner (4 minutes, 53.12 seconds) and the SJ-O varsity 3,200 relay was victorious in 8:45.42.
Five of the Spartans’ wins were in the freshmen-sophomore division, including a sparkling 3:48.54 clocking in the 1,600-meter relay. The time not only won the frosh-soph category, but was faster than Kankakee posted in winning the varsity 1,600 relay (3:48.91).
Sophomore Aidan McCorkle was the frosh-soph 400-meter winner (53.31). Sophomore Tyler Burch took top honors in the frosh-soph 100 meters (11.61).
Freshman Brock Trimble prevailed in the frosh-soph discus (130-4). Sophomore Hunter Ketchum won the frosh-soph shot put (39-10 ¼ ) and was the runner-up to Trimble in the discus (112-0).
Senior Brady Buss was a two-event placer. He ran second in the 200 meters (23.13) and placed fifth in the 100 meters (11.66).
Trimble and McCorkle also placed in a second event. McCorkle finished fourth in the varsity long jump (19-0 ½ ). Trimble took sixth in the varsity triple jump (35-5).
Two Spartan relays ended second in frosh-soph races. The 3,200-meter relay took the runner-up spot (9:34.69) as did the 800-meter unit (1:45.94).
Elijah Mock (800 meters, 2:12.25) and Spencer Wilson (400 frosh-soph, 57.47) added third-place finishes.
